Last post Jun 07, 2010 06:41 AM by Vinija
Jun 07, 2010 02:49 AM|pinoyz|LINK
Hi to all,
I'm using a WCF in my application, this service is included in the page(s) (class is seperated from svc file). I configured the wcf as a ajax enabled(compatibility) and i also used pagemethod to kill the session and cookies.
Unfortunately in our production, I got an error of 'Could not load file or assembly App_web_....'.
To fix my problem, I need to delete the svc file and copy the svc file from my project bin and paste it to the prod...
Of course i need a solid solution for this.
Jun 07, 2010 04:45 AM|Vinija|LINK
Is your class (code behind) file in seperate project?
Does your .svc file ahs CodeBehind attribute in it?
(If so, delete it)
Jun 07, 2010 05:51 AM|pinoyz|LINK
My Class is in seperate project.
<%@ ServiceHost Language="C#" Debug="true" Service="MAXCustomService.CustomService" %>
Jun 07, 2010 06:01 AM|Vinija|LINK
Check the namespace of the service class
Jun 07, 2010 06:18 AM|pinoyz|LINK
Actually, It runs okay last friday (GMT+8) but now i got that error...
My leads test it and got an error in ajax (MAXCustomService is undefine) and checked the service. I got that error.
I resolve the issue when i copy the svc file to my project and paste it to the production.
this is the second time it happened. But i need a solid solution for this :(
Jun 07, 2010 06:41 AM|Vinija|LINK
It could be that whenever you change method signature (Add / remove methods, change parameters. change method names etc.) it may happend.
You need, whenever you deploey the service class'es DLL, to copy the .svc file as well.